[PATCH] I2O: more error checking
i2o_scsi: handle sysfs failure
i2o_device:
* convert i2o_device_add() to return integer error code
rather than pointer. Fortunately -nobody- checks the return code of
this function, so changing has nil impact.
* handle errors thrown by device_register()
More work in i2o_device remains.
